A crush on David Archuleta

A crush on David Archuleta

David Archuleta may have scored the runner-up position on the seventh season of American Idol but the sweetie-pie is springing back from the karaoke contest with a new killer tune Crush.

The Australian release date is yet to be confirmed but the track is stirring up the sound waves in the US and is currently in second position on the Billboard charts.

Archuleta is a combination of a more masculine-sound-ing version of Anthony Callea and Jesse McCartney’s sex appeal -“ the teen queens and twinks seem to love him.

Crush is a likeable song with an incredible chorus that heightens his strong pop-rock vocal ability. Make sure you check him out on YouTube or iTunes.
